Bigben Interactive Debt-to-Assets Ratio Growth & History (BIG)
Bigben Interactive's debt-to-assets ratio was 0.16 for fiscal 2025.

| Fiscal year | Period ended | Debt-to-assets ratio |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 2025-03-31 | 0.16 | −0.10 | −38.86% |
| 2024 | 2024-03-31 | 0.26 | −0.01 | −3.86% |
| 2023 | 2023-03-30 | 0.27 | 0.25 | +1184.60% |
| 2022 | 2022-03-31 | 0.02 | 0.00 | +14.85% |
| 2021 | 2021-03-31 | 0.02 | — | — |

Bigben Interactive debt-to-assets ratio trends
Between the periods ended 2021-03-31 and 2025-03-31, Bigben Interactive's debt-to-assets ratio increased from 0.02 to 0.16, a change of 0.14. The latest reported quarter, Q2 2026, shows 0.30.
About the metric
What the debt-to-assets ratio means
The debt-to-assets ratio shows the portion of a company’s reported assets financed with interest-bearing debt. It is a leverage measure and should not be confused with total liabilities divided by assets.
Calculation and source
How debt-to-assets is calculated
TickerStat calculates debt-to-assets as total interest-bearing debt divided by total assets at the same reporting-period end. Periods with missing debt or non-positive assets are omitted.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so exact period-end dates are included.
